Common searches

Search results

Display options

Re: Where do I download the games?

And I'd like to add really quick that being a very picky shopper, to not rush into a so called 'deal'. Sometimes if you just wait even a day, you find what you paid for a game (thinking you really got a great deal) you ended up paying an extra 6 bucks or more that you could have kept to buy other …

Page 1 of 1